Defendant was charged with, and subsequently indicted for, unlawfully receiving a motor vehicle knowing it to have been stolen, in violation of N.J.S.A. Defendant Kevin Godfrey was arrested on Jby Officer Edward Rodriguez of the Englewood Cliffs Police Department when he found defendant in possession of a Chevrolet van motor vehicle which he ascertained had been stolen earlier that day, or the day before, in Unionville, New York. *137 The opinion of the court was delivered by HALPERN, P.J.A.D.Ī brief summary of the events leading to the present indictment is necessary to understand the issues presented.
